MercyOne Siouxland Foundation Adds Members to Board of Directors
The MercyOne Siouxland Foundation is happy to announce the addition of three new members to their board of directors. Dawn Prosser of the Diocese of Sioux City, Clinton Vos with GCC Ready Mix, and Angel Wallace of the City of Sioux City are joining the board.
The MercyOne Siouxland Foundation is a separately incorporated 501(c)3 Corporation governed by a volunteer board. Saul Gomez of Gomez Pallets is the board chair; Sarah Hansen, a community volunteer, is the vice chair; Chris Gill of Metro Electric is the treasurer; and Beau Braunger of NAI United is the secretary.
“We are excited to welcome Dawn, Clinton and Angel to the board. I know they all will bring great energy and knowledge to the group,” said Gomez.
The MercyOne Siouxland Foundation exists to support the mission of MercyOne Siouxland Medical Center by generating and providing resources and promoting community involvement. Gifts to the MercyOne Siouxland Foundation establish or enhance programs, improve or build facilities and purchase equipment that would otherwise be unavailable due to budget constraints. The focus of the Foundation is on improving service to patients.
